Mission: Our Mission is to improve the quality of life for Morris County families by addressing economic, educational, social and physical fitness needs while preserving the cultural and ethnic diversity of the area. Our Goals The goals of the Spring Street Community Development Corporation include but are not limited to: -Improving the availability of safe and affordable housing -Supporting youth through educational programming -Promoting, coordinating, supporting and providing social and community services to families -Create Healthy Actions thru Nutrition & Group Exercise -Fostering and participating in regional planning and development so as to support the efforts of local governmental units -Protecting and preserving the natural resources while promoting their sustainable use -Expanding opportunities for individuals and groups to own and operate business enterprises -Reducing unemployment and underemployment

I volunteer for SSCDC's SOAR program assisting just over 30 fifth graders with their homework assignments, helping them learn to use Microsoft Word, and showing them research tricks using the Google search engine. Some of the children do not have computers of their own and SOAR provides them their only opportunity to use computers outside of school. I hope to find sources of computers that can be refurbished and given to those in need so they can learn the vital basic use of computers.
